How they compare
New Zealand currently reports -12.86 billion against -20.81 billion in India, a difference of 7.95 billion.
The two have swapped places 10 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2005 it was New Zealand ahead.
India ranks 185th and New Zealand ranks 182nd of 193 countries.
New Zealand has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
The World and Country Group Aggregates (historically called BOPSY) is an annual publication, released each November, of major balance of payments and international investment position components for countries, country groups, and the world.
